CBR's 15 Best Movies With the Worst Endings

"A movie's end should bring a sense of closure. While a good ending shouldn't be entirely predictable, it should certainly match what came before it. Sometimes, however, an ending will miss the mark. It might try and be too clever or come as such a surprise that it doesn't provide any satisfaction for the audience. A great movie will make sure that the audience gets attached to its characters. As such, the ending should fit their journey. However, bad endings sometimes sacrifice previously established goodwill in favor of an unearned surprise. Others go too far and shatter the audience's suspension of disbelief. Even great films can drop the ball at the last second. It's not enough to ruin the whole film, but it can leave a bad taste in viewers' mouths." - cbr.com
